Called a bird in for my brother about 45 minutes ago. Watched him top the hill at 15 yards, "kill him"....."kill him"......putt, putt, gone. He'd miscoursed the drumming by a few degrees and couldn't get turned on him.

First bird I'd really ever hunted on this piece of private. Saw him while out riding and checking fields yesterday evening.

Now moved to the other side of place and listening to birds gobbling in two directions off of our property.
